The Post-Gazette's Mike White turned a few heads with this interesting tweet this week regarding one of Pitt's top recruiting targets for 2014, Shai McKenzie:

As we noted back in June, Florida State and Pitt appeared to be at the top of his list (if one took that list to be in order of most desirable to least). At that time, Virginia Tech was listed fourth. It really only reinforces what I stated before in that it's still way too early to try to make a prediction on what McKenzie will do. Per Gobbler Country, SB Nation's Virginia Tech blog, don't expect a decision anytime soon. And even if one were made at this point, there's a long way to go until Signing Day. The list is likely changing constantly and there's no real idea on where it will end up. The only important thing is that Pitt is still in the mix.

I've said it before but it bears repeating. Paul Chryst is doing a great job in building the offensive line and McKenzie should thrive in that situation. Dorian Johnson, Michael Grimm, Adam Bisnowaty ... those are building blocks. And when you look at all the depth on the line that Chryst has stockpiled, it's clearly the biggest priority.
